#bad266 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bad266 is composed of 72.9% red, 82.4%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.4%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 73.3 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 61.2%. #bad266 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ffcc with #75a500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#bad266 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bad266 has RGB values of R:186, G:210,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 12243558.

Shades and Tints of #bad266
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0e04 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bad266
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9d9b is the less saturated color, while #cff840 is the most saturated one.
